Most miss the point of this course 2+ years

Reviewed: Played on:Sep 20, 2007 Played the course:2-4 times

Pros:

Ball golfers might remember that most metro areas had "pitch + putt" courses that you played with a wedge a putter and the long hole might require a 7 iron if you had no distance in your shots. That is what this is. So when judging it judge it for the short game practice facility it is and looking at in that light it succeeds quite well. The ideal use of this course would be play this get warmed up then drive the mile and a half and play Sinnissippi which is one of the better courses in the state.

Cons:

Holes are bunched together tightly so be aware of other players. NOT a destination course unless used in conjunction with Sinnissippi and Genseo.

Other Thoughts:

If this was in metro Chicago close to some decent courses it would be used constantly day and night. As is it is out in the middle of IL

Putt Putt in Rock Falls, IL 2+ years drive by

Reviewed: Played on:Aug 24, 2008 Played the course:once

Pros:

Nice little park and short course. The trees have arrows on them telling you which basket it the right one. very easy to follow. Signs for every hole. A quick round of 18 holes

Cons:

Dirt tees, Hole 2 or 3 plays over a playgroud. And Basket 18 is very near the parking area. I was worred about hitting a car.

Other Thoughts:

I know a lot of players will not like this course as it is very short, as a lot don't like the course around here that is 200ft to 325ft.
We only used a putter and had a good time playing here. There is a shelter house here at the front that was getting busy when we were leaving. They were getting ready to have a family reunion so the park maybe busy during the warmer months.
